NATIONAL STADIUM, KARACHI
(Redirected from People\'s Sports Complex)
The 'National Stadium' is a cricket stadium in Karachi, Pakistan. It is currently used for cricket matches, and is home to Pakistan's national and Karachi's domestic cricket teams. The stadium is able to hold aboout 40,000 spectators[1], making it the second largest stadium in Pakistan after Gaddafi Stadium in Lahore. Its widely criticised that the city of this size with a population of over 15 million having such a small capacity stadium. In the recent past, PCB has announced on different occasions that the capacity of the stadium will be increased to 50,000 but this approval looks a bit stale at the moment.
The Pakistani cricket team have a remarkable Test record at the ground, having only lost once (vs. England, December 2000-01) and have won 21 times in 39 Test Matches and in over 50 years. The stadium has witnessed several memorable moments, such as Viv Richards 181 against Sri Lanka at the 1987 Cricket World Cup, Mohammad Yousuf's record ninth century of the year to break Viv Richards record of most runs in a calendar year, and Kamran Akmal's famous century against India on a very difficult pitch in 2006, after Pakistan had collapsed to 39 for 6, as part of a memorable come-from-behind victory.

Records
Test
★ 'Highest Team Total': 599, by Pakistan against India in 2006.
★ 'Lowest Team Total': 80, by Australia against Pakistan in 1956.
★ 'Highest Run Chase Achieved': 315/9, by Pakistan against Australia in 1994-95.
★ 'Highest Individual Score': 211, by Javed Miandad against Australia in 1988.
★ 'Highest partnership': 298, by Aamir Sohail and Ijaz Ahmed against West Indies in 1997-98.
One Day International
★ 'Highest team total': 360, by West Indies against Sri Lanka, October 13, 1987.
★ 'Lowest team total': 122, by New Zealand against Pakistan, April 21, 2002.
★ 'Highest Run Chase Achieved': 306/5, by England against Pakistan in 2000-01.
★ 'Highest Run Chase (Won or Loss)' 344/8 by Pakistan against India, March 13, 2004.
★ 'Highest individual score': 181, by Viv Richards against Sri Lanka, October 13, 1987.
★ 'Highest partnership': 200, by Shoaib Malik and Mohammad Yousuf against Sri Lanka in 2004-05.
